Glad that you like it! I use the same mouse but in a different color, I think it's the 'Retro' style. For me it's one of the best mice I ever had. One thing: it will start double clicking sooner or later with the lowest debounce setting. Also the switches were way too noisy for me. You can find replacement pcbs with switches of your choice for really cheap on eBay.

The shape of the mouse is good but the surface of the mouse is extremely slippery to me, borderline unusable. I applied grip tape to contact points of my fingers and I still feel like it would be more ideal to apply grip tape all over the mouse surface, for how bad it is. Fortunately, they did solve this issue with the M68, having a more traditional, UV treated surface. I genuinely don't know how they thought releasing the M8 with this surface would have been a good idea at all.

I picked up the Xtrfy M8 yesterday for 290 SEK (~31 USD). At that price it almost felt wrong not to try it. The only color left was frosty mint, which honestly isn’t my first choice, but in person it actually looks better than I expected — kind of a weirdly clean pastel vibe. For context, my main mouse has been the Razer DeathAdder V3 Pro for a long time, so that’s what I’m comparing it against. First impressions: The M8 immediately felt different in a good way. The shape is flatter and shorter than the DA V3 Pro, and surprisingly comfortable for me. The overall feel in the hand is actually nicer — more “fun” I guess — even though the DA V3 Pro is obviously the more high-end product. Build quality on the M8 is solid, no creaking, and it doesn’t feel like a 31-dollar mouse at all. Weight & shape: The M8 is lighter (around 55g) compared to the DA V3 Pro (about 63–64g), but the bigger difference is the shape. The DA is long, ergonomic, and fills the hand. The M8 feels more compact and agile, and that ended up being a positive surprise. If you like flatter, more neutral shapes, the M8 is honestly great. Sensor & performance: This is where the DA V3 Pro wins easily. Razer’s Focus Pro 30K sensor and the wireless performance are still top-tier. The M8 uses Pixart 3395 sensor, which is still really good — accurate, responsive, no issues — but it’s not at the same level when you look at specs (on paper). Switches & scroll wheel: The switches on both mice are good, but the M8’s scroll wheel surprised me the most. I actually prefer it over the DA V3 Pro. It feels more defined and satisfying to use. Clicks feel crisp but maybe a bit louder, depending on how picky you are. Looks: I hate to admit it, but the M8 looks better on my desk. Even in frosty mint. The design is just more interesting and unique compared to the very plain DA V3 Pro. Overall: Objectively, the Razer DeathAdder V3 Pro is the better mouse. Better sensor, better wireless, better in almost every technical category. But subjectively, I’ve been enjoying the Xtrfy M8 more. The shape, the look, and especially the scroll wheel just hit the right spot for me. For 290 SEK, it’s honestly a steal. If you’re curious and can find it for anywhere near this price, it’s 100% worth trying — even if you own a higher-end mouse already. Note: This is not a professional review, this is mostly my first impression of the mouse. TL;DR: Got the Xtrfy M8 for 290 SEK. Even though the DA V3 Pro is objectively the superior mouse (sensor, battery, wireless, specs), I actually prefer the M8 because of its shape, looks, and way better scroll wheel. Frosty mint isn’t my favorite color but it grew on me. For the price, the M8 is insanely good.
